Time&Space is a comprehensive and flexible solution for Access Control and Workforce Management, providing a multitude of scalable solutions. The software and hardware is fully modular and has been designed to work together seamlessly.

Spica's access control hardware is designed to offer the greatest flexibility of installation and configuration; all with as few design variants as possible. Controllers are capable of integrating with a wide variety of branded and unbranded identification technologies (including HID, Aperio, Bioscrypt, Legic, Deister, Mifare and many others). It all connects over Ethernet to provide a true IP solution, with PoE an option on all devices.

Time&Space Access Control (Space) offers all of the functionality you would expect of a quality access control system. Along with standard features, such as multiple badges per user and fully-configurable role-based authorisation, additional modules the enable integration of numerous IP CCTV camera models, interactive map supervision and control, visitor management and full enrolment and distribution of fingerprint templates.

Using the same database, a wide variety of workforce management functions can also be added. Time&Space (Time) offers a comprehensive and professional time management suite, working in real time from data captured from access points or dedicated time registration terminals. In addition to the strong standard functionality, there are options to enable easy integration to payroll and other 3rd-party systems, approval workflows, rostering and even job costing.

 Thus Time&Space is a complete solution that can solve many of a company’s concerns in a single, fully-integrated package.
